The same week the Holy Father is dropping in on Juarez, this side of the border will observe Presidents' Day.

With the federal holiday falling on Monday, Feb. 15, and Pope Francis set to spend most of Wednesday, Feb. 17 in Juarez many Borderland students will have a shorter than usual school week. His stopover has resulted in all but one school district suspending classes for the day amid traffic, security, and absenteeism concerns.

But not every ISD is taking Presidents' Day off. Here's a district by district breakdown:

● Canutillo ISD – No school Monday or Wednesday
● Gadsden ISD – No school Monday or Wednesday
● Anthony ISD – No school Monday or Wednesday
● Clint ISD – No school Monday, classes Wednesday
● Ysleta ISD – School Monday, but not Wednesday
● Socorro ISD – School Monday, but not Wednesday
● San Eli ISD – School Monday, but not Wednesday
● Fabens ISD – School Monday, but not Wednesday
● El Paso ISD – School Monday, but not Wednesday
